Book description
In LA there's a killer on the loose. He kills young and rootless girls
and he always kills in threes. Back in Dublin, Ed Loy, happy in a new
relationship, is reunited with Jack Donovan, a film director friend from
LA with a turbulent personal history. When the third young female extra
fails to show for work on Jack's movie, Loy begins to suspect Jack. And
when the previous victims of the 'Three-in-One Killer' are discovered in
LA at locations Jack used for his movies, Loy's suspicion hardens. Loy
flies to LA to liaise with the LAPD on their investigation. He must find
something in his and Jack's shared past that can point to the killer,
and hope against hope that whatever he finds will point away from his
old friend. And then, when he finally unearths the truth, it looks like
it may be too late. Back in Dublin, the 'Three-in-One Killer' has broken
his pattern, broken cover and struck at Ed Loy where he is most
vulnerable. Time is not on Loy's side as he mounts a desperate fight to
outwit a ruthless psychopath and save the last of the lost girls.
